Output 3a59dfd14bd950a578fdf98b4557b91591c0ddd1f92aec56ba5bafbeff1aed60:1

value
74888
script pubkey
OP_0 OP_PUSHBYTES_20 4c6f6fbacb69c36f275bee168c344bae911d02b9
address
bc1qf3hklwktd8pk7f6mactgcdzt46g36q4er34kg4
transaction
3a59dfd14bd950a578fdf98b4557b91591c0ddd1f92aec56ba5bafbeff1aed60
confirmations
15074
spent
true